Here we have, for your listening pleasure, four new songs for the myspace world: * "Dream" is brand new. Complete with a squeaky sustain pedal on the piano. * "Take Me Away" was only played live once. (Think C,S,N,Y meets Sun Kil Moon) It's basically about how even a thing like baseball can break your heart sometimes... * "August Breeze" is an old favorite of mine, written in August of 2001, and parts of it have been re-recorded recently. Perfect for those long Autumn sunsets... * Finally, "Morning Star" is a lost recording. I found it on a tape with no label, no indication, no history. I was surprised to know that I actually had recorded this song. One take, one track, two mics...it was written for an ungrateful muse many moons ago... *And since myspace has allowed me to now have SIX songs, I am pleased to bring back a couple of old favorites of mine: Broken Lullaby and Hey There, Stars. Enjoy and thank you for listening. Let me know what you think!
